  • Calling an Overridden Method from a Parent-Class Constructor

    - by Vaibhav Bajpai
    I tried calling an overridden method from a constructor of a parent class and noticed different behavior across languages. C++ - echoes A.foo() class A{ public: A(){foo();} virtual void foo(){cout<<"A.foo()";} }; class B : public A{ public: B(){} void foo(){cout<<"B.foo()";} }; int main(){ B *b = new B(); } Java - echoes B.foo() class A{ public A(){foo();} public void foo(){System.out.println("A.foo()");} } class B extends A{ public void foo(){System.out.println("B.foo()");} } class Demo{ public static void main(String args[]){ B b = new B(); } } C# - echoes B.foo() class A{ public A(){foo();} public virtual void foo(){Console.WriteLine("A.foo()");} } class B : A{ public override void foo(){Console.WriteLine("B.foo()");} } class MainClass { public static void Main (string[] args) { B b = new B(); } } I realize that in C++ objects are created from top-most parent going down the hierarchy, so when the constructor calls the overridden method, B does not even exist, so it calls the A' version of the method. However, I am not sure why I am getting different behavior in Java and C#.
